  • FIG. 1 and 2 show an electric shock insecticide of the present invention, which is used by hanging it from a ceiling or the like.
  • This unit is mounted on a unique design case 2 of UF 0 using a round light 5, and a ballast for the light and a high-voltage generating transformer 10 for electric shock and insect killing are installed in this case 2. And a printed circuit board 11 such as a rectifier circuit.
  • Transformer 10 has a primary winding that operates as a stabilizer and generates a high voltage in the secondary winding. The generated secondary AC high voltage is rectified by a rectifier 17 to double the voltage, which is charged to a capacitor 18. The charged DC high voltage is applied to the electric shock Yuko 7.
  • the resistor 15 and the capacitor 16 are intended to prevent the circuit from being affected even if the secondary side is short-circuited (eg, by insects killed by electric shock).
  • the mercury switch 12 is designed to turn off the power when the instrument is tilted.
  • Protective grid 6 is for safety against high-pressure parts, and conventional small-sized electric shock insects ⁇ could not remove large insects because the distance between the protective grids could not be widened. Since the upper part of 5 is wide open, it is effective to kill large, small and small insects by electric shock so that large insects can be sufficiently inserted. -There is no need to worry about your finger touching the grid 7 at the top of the indicator light 5. The insects killed in this way are received at Receipt 8. Receiving 8 easily removes worms.

Abstract

Un appareil insecticide sert egalement d'appareil d'eclairage. L'appareil insecticide comprend un boitier ayant une bride de projection formee le long du bord inferieur d'une hemisphere, un transformateur (10) loge dans le boitier (2) et servant de stabilisateur et de generateur haute tension, une unite insecticide, et une lampe d'attraction d'insectes (5). Le transformateur (10) comprend un premier enroulement comportant au moins deux bobines (A), (B) pour le stabilisateur de la lampe d'attraction d'insectes, lesquelles bobines sont enroulees sur un noyau en fer simple, et un enroulement secondaire pour generer une haute tension. Lorsque l'appareil est utilise comme dispositif insecticide a chocs electriques, une grille de chocs electriques (7) est fixee sur la partie centrale de la lampe d'attraction circulaire (5). En allumant la lampe une haute tension insecticide est simultanement appliquee sur la grille de chocs (7). Si l'appareil doit etre utilise comme un dispositif de piege pour insectes, un cylindre adhesif de piege a insectes (19) contenant un agent d'attraction d'insectes peut etre substitue et fixe sur la partie centrale de la lampe d'attraction circulaire (5). L'appareil peut egalement servir a la fois de dispositif d'eclairage et de dispositif insecticide a chocs electriques en remplacant la lampe d'attraction circulaire d'insectes (5) par une lampe fluorescente et en montant une lampe d'attraction du type a baguette dans le centre de la grille de chocs.
